Woman molested in Nigdi in broad daylight; 1 held

Pune: In a shocking incident, a 29-year-old woman was molested in broad daylight in Akurdi on Thursday. A case in this regard has been registered at Nigdi police station.

The police arrested the accused who was identified as Sagar Paramane (40), a resident of Bijli Nagar in Chinchwad.

Paramane works with a private firm in Chinchwad.

Vijay Kumar Palsule, Police Inspector, Nigdi police station, said, “The incident occurred around 11.30 am on Thursday at a footpath near Satguru Auto Garage in Akurdi. Paramane forced himself on the complainant who was walking on the footpath. He forcefully kissed her and groped her.”

“We have arrested the accused who is trying to act as if he is mentally unstable. But as per our the investigation, we have found that he is perfectly normal and to get away from his crime he is pretending to be unstable.”

The police have registered a case under section 354 (Assault or criminal force to woman with intent to outrage her modesty), 354A (Sexual Harassment and punishment for sexual harassment), 354B (Assault or use of Criminal force to woman with intent to disrobe) of Indian Penal Code against the accused.
